>Thanks to dark, the STFC error problem now has a solution, and what a simple 
>one it is. If Thomas or anyone had any of Bill Engvall's famous signs to hand 
>out, I'm sure a lot of us would be wearing them. It seems that when you 
>download the DirectX file and run it, you aren't exactly installing the 
>program. You must then go to wherever you extracted the files to and run the 
>Dxsetup executable. Then, and only then, will the program be installed. Out of 
>desperation I tried this and, needless to say, it worked. So I'm off to boldly 
>go where no man has gone...well you know. The point is Dark was right, so he
